Development of GIS Application Component for Supporting Administration Business of Local Government (지자체 행정업무 지원을위한 GIS 응용 컴포넌트 개발 : 토지 민원서비스 컴포넌트)

  • 서창완;김태현;이덕호;김일석
    • Spatial Information Research
    • /
    • v.8 no.1
    • /
    • pp.15-29
    • /
    • 2000
  • In the Recent rapidly changing technology environment the computerization of administration business which is driven or will be driven to give improved information services to people by local government or central government with a huge budget. The possibility of applying GIS application component to the computerization of administration business is investigated to prevent local government from investing redundant money and to reuse the existing investment at this point of time. Land civil service application component was developed at the $\ulcorner Development of Open GIS Component S/W \lrcorner$ project which was managed by Ministry of Information and Communication . GIS application component was based on Open GIS OLE/COM specification for development of standard interface and USD(Unified System Development ) for development method and UML (Unified Modeling Language) for system design and Visual C++ for component implementation. Implemented components were Process Control, Map, Print, Statistics component and were verified by using Visual Basic and Delhi. tis study shows that the development of component is very useful at the GIS application development for local governments. But the standard of business and data and system is the essential prerequisite to maximize business application.

Development of Active Data Mining Component for Web Database Applications (웹 데이터베이스 응용을 위한 액티브데이터마이닝 컴포넌트 개발)

  • Choi, Yong-Goo
    • Journal of Information Technology Applications and Management
    • /
    • v.15 no.2
    • /
    • pp.1-14
    • /
    • 2008
  • The distinguished prosperity of information technologies from great progress of e-business during the last decade has unavoidably made software development for active data mining to discovery hidden predictive information regarding business trends and behavior from vary large databases. Therefore this paper develops an active mining object(ADMO) component, which provides real-time predictive information from web databases. The ADMO component is to extended ADO(ActiveX Data Object) component to active data mining component based on COM(Component Object Model) for application program interface(API). ADMO component development made use of window script component(WSC) based on XML(eXtensible Markup Language). For the purpose of investigating the application environments and the practical schemes of the ADMO component, experiments for diverse practical applications were performed in this paper. As a result, ADMO component confirmed that it could effectively extract the analytic information of classification and aggregation from vary large databases for Web services.

EFFECT ON THE SHEAR BOND STRENGTH OF A COMPOMER TO DENTIN ACCORDING TO SURFACE CONDITIONING (상아질 표면처리방법이 compomer의 전단결합 강도에 미치는 영향에 관한 연구)

  • Kim, Soo-Mee;Cho, Young-Gon;Moon, Joo-Hoon
    • Restorative Dentistry and Endodontics
    • /
    • v.23 no.2
    • /
    • pp.597-606
    • /
    • 1998
  • The purpose of this study was to evaluate the shear bond strength of the Compoglass Carvifil bonded on the dentin surface according to etching or non-etching and two time application or three time application of single component. Human non-carious 60 extracted 3rd molar were used. The occlusal dentin surfaces of all teeth were exposed with Diamond Wheel Saw and polished with Lapping & Polishing machine(South Bay Technology Co., U.S.A). The teeth were then distributed randomly into four groups of 15 teeth each and dentin surface were conditioned as following. Control group : Non-etching, two times application of Syntac Single Component. (According to manufacture's instruction) Experimental group 1 : Non-etching, three times application of Syntac Single Component. Experimental group : 2 Etching, two times application of Syntac Single Component. Experimental group 3 : Etching, three times application of Syntac Single Component. Compoglass were bonded to exposed dentin surfaces and all samples were placed in distilled water for 7 days. The shear bond strengths were measured by universal testing machine (SHIMADAZU AUTOGRAPH, AGS-4D., Japan). The results were as follows : 1. Experimental group 3 revealed the highest value (30.75${\pm}$4.74 MPa) and control group revealed the lowest value(14.85${\pm}$2.69 MPa). There was significant difference of shear bond strength among four groups(P<0.01) 2. The acid-etching groups (experimental group 2, 3) had higher shear bond strengths than non etching groups(control group and experimental group 1). 3. The additional application of Syntac single component groups revealed a higher bond strength than two times application groups (control group and experimental group 2).
